Job description

This is a garden restoration job. New owners require an experienced Gardener to work closely with them to lead the restoration and development of a once great garden on a beautiful part of the West Coast of Scotland. The position is full time and permanent and would suit an experienced and hands-on gardener who is passionate, experienced and knowledgeable especially about trees and woody perennials. The individual will have to be self-driven and able to be productive operating with a high degree of autonomy.

Planted from the 1860’s onwards, the garden is currently 20 acres, with abundant yet to be catalogued mature trees including Wellingtonia, Rhododendrons, Azaleas, Magnolias and similar ericaceous species and cultivars. Maintained to a high standard until the early part of this century, the extraordinary plants and the views are disappearing under bracken, brambles and self-sown trees. The Gardener will be responsible for the planning and management of the restoration with the help of a Groundsperson and possibly one other.

There will be assistance from a small not yet experienced team, so the individual taking this role must be happy to lead others, being very hands on in all aspects of gardening including weeding, planting, composting, propagation, monitoring plant welfare, chainsaw work and vegetable growing amongst other duties. He / She will be able to balance a sense of ownership of the garden with the owners’ actual ownership and personal preferences. Personal resourcefulness and resilience are important in a remote coastal location albeit with a vibrant local and busy if seasonal tourist community. Honesty, trustworthiness and the ability to receive and give feedback are crucial.

Applicants will ideally hold professional level horticultural qualifications ideally gained while training at an RHS garden and/or have trained in a significant private garden. Understanding the nature of a privately owned garden is key. He/She will have deep knowledge and experience of large scale weed eradication and management, mostly using sustainable techniques. Particular interest in soil development and plant nutrition and experience of acid soil garden(s) will be sought. Chainsaw and spraying certification would be advantageous. There is a range of garden machinery available for use and the gardener will need to have the ability to operate and carry out basic maintenance of the garden machinery.

A two-bedroom cottage onsite is provided rent free for the successful applicant. Partners, pets and children are welcome. Council tax and bills e.g., water and electricity are the tenant’s responsibility.
